**Job Title: Material Handler**
**Job Description**
This role supports a custom industrial packaging manufacturer that produces large custom crates and corrugated cardboard boxes.

As a Material Handler, you will manage materials from receipt through to staging for production, combining hands-on forklift work with inventory control, shipping and receiving, and documentation.

You will ensure that every component, from lumber to nuts and bolts, is picked accurately and prepared safely for production and outbound shipments.
**Responsibilities**
Operate a propane counterbalance forklift (tow motor) to safely move, stage, and pick materials, including non-standard lumber loads, for the production team.

Load and unload various sized loads from trucks and trailers, ensuring safe handling and proper placement of all materials.

Conduct accurate inventory counts, including tracking nuts, bolts, screws, foam, pallets, and other components to the exact quantities required.

Pick and stage all materials for production orders, ensuring each item and quantity matches the specifications on work orders and shipping documents.

Use computer systems to perform shipping and receiving tasks, including data entry and updating inventory records.

Create and process bills of lading (BOLs) and other shipping documents to support accurate and timely shipments.

Retrieve stored product from outdoor storage areas using the propane counterbalance forklift, ensuring safe operation in all weather conditions.

Assist with maintaining clear access to shipping doors, including shoveling snow from the back shipping door during heavy snowfall to keep loading areas accessible.

Communicate with production, engineering, and sales teams as needed to ensure materials are available and correctly staged for ongoing work.

Follow all safety procedures and company policies while maintaining a clean, organized, and efficient work area.

Support team members and contribute to a collaborative, team-focused work culture within the shop.
**Essential Skills**
At least 2 years of experience operating a propane counterbalance forklift (tow motor), including handling non-standard loads such as lumber.

Valid counterbalance propane forklift license with demonstrated practical experience.

Hands-on material handling experience in a manufacturing, warehouse, or industrial environment.

Proven shipping and receiving experience, including creating and processing bills of lading (BOLs).

Solid computer skills with the ability to perform data entry and use software for shipping, receiving, and inventory tasks.

Inventory control experience, including conducting inventory counts and maintaining accurate stock records.

High attention to detail with the ability to pick exact quantities of multiple small components and materials.

Comfort operating a forklift both indoors and outdoors, including retrieving materials from external storage areas.

Ability to work day shifts from Monday to Friday, 6:30 a.m. to 3:00 p.m.

Capability to perform physical tasks such as moving materials and assisting with snow shoveling at the back shipping door when required.
